Comanche County Detention Center 24 Hour Booking

The Comanche County Detention Center inmate search is the primary tool for checking 24 hour booking records in Lawton. The facility sits at 315 SW 5th Street, 73501. The phone number is 580-250-1902. You can search by name or booking number. Each record shows gender, date of birth, height, weight, race, booking details, charges, bond amount, and housing assignment.

The detention center has 284 beds. It processes bookings for Lawton and all other cities in Comanche County. That includes arrests made by the Lawton Police Department, the Comanche County Sheriff, and other agencies in the area. The facility runs 24 hours a day, seven days a week. New bookings are added to the online system as they come in. If someone was arrested in Lawton an hour ago, their record could already be in the search tool.

The Comanche County inmate search gives you a good amount of detail. Each booking record includes the person's full name, gender, date of birth, and physical description. You also see the booking date and time, the charges filed, the bond amount, and the housing unit they are assigned to. This is more info than many county search tools provide.

The search tool updates as new bookings happen. If you do not find someone right away, wait a bit and try again. The intake process takes time, and the record does not appear until booking is complete. For people who were recently arrested, there can be a short delay between the arrest and when the record shows up online. If you need an answer right away, call the detention center at 580-250-1902 and ask the staff directly.

Visitation and 24 Hour Booking Contact

The Comanche County Detention Center uses video visitation. Sessions are available from 8am to 10pm daily. You need to schedule your visit at least 24 hours in advance. This is different from the old walk-in visitation model that many jails used to have. Video visits are conducted through screens at the facility or, in some cases, remotely.

Money deposits for inmates are accepted Monday through Friday from 8:30am to 4pm. If you need to add funds to an inmate's account for commissary or phone calls, plan to do it during those hours. The facility does not take deposits on weekends. For questions about visitation rules or deposit procedures, call the detention center. Rules can change, so it is always smart to call ahead before you make the trip.

Comanche County Sheriff and 24 Hour Booking

The Comanche County Sheriff's Office runs the detention center. The sheriff handles law enforcement across the county's 1,069 square miles. That is a large area. Besides Lawton, the county includes Cache, Indiahoma, Fletcher, Sterling, Elgin, Geronimo, Chattanooga, and Medicine Park. Fort Sill, the Army post, is also in Comanche County. Arrests from any of these places go through the same 24 hour booking process at the county detention center.

The sheriff's office handles patrol, investigations, civil process, and jail operations. If you need to reach them about a booking or an inmate issue, the detention center number is the best bet. The sheriff's main office handles administrative matters. For anything related to a specific arrest or booking, go through the jail staff. They have direct access to the records and can give you the most current information.

After a booking in Lawton, the case goes to Comanche County District Court. You can search these cases for free on OSCN. The system shows charges, hearing dates, and case outcomes. It covers all Comanche County cases, so Lawton arrests will show up here along with arrests from other county cities.

The OSBI CHIRP system costs $15 and does a statewide criminal history search. This is useful if you want to check for arrests beyond Comanche County. CHIRP covers all 77 Oklahoma counties and returns results within minutes. For tracking an inmate's status in real time, VINE lets you register for free alerts when their custody status changes. VINE covers the Comanche County Detention Center.

Fort Sill and Lawton Area Bookings

Fort Sill sits right next to Lawton. Military arrests on post are handled by military police and go through the military justice system. Those do not show up in the Comanche County booking records. But when military personnel are arrested off post by civilian law enforcement, they go through the standard county booking process just like anyone else. Those records will be in the detention center's system.

The Lawton area also sees arrests related to traffic on Interstate 44 and Highway 62. State troopers and local agencies make stops along these corridors, and the resulting bookings end up at the Comanche County Detention Center. So the facility handles a mix of local, county, and highway-related arrests, all processed through the same 24 hour booking system.
